Descripción
Summary:The paper explores the grammar in the speech of a two-year old Bengali-speaking child. Though language acquisition process is still a mystery, linguists throughout the world confirm that it follows a systematic process in case of any language of the world. However, they have tried hard to discover the grammar in the speech of children. This research is such an attempt to apply the theories of first language acquisition to a Bengali speaking child which identifies that children’s speech is ‘grammatical’ as they follow a systematic pattern.
